Output 91abb60091ef647466dcbc0920be9e87aa5f57186972efae70633921e3d9d626:3

value
64553612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50e47831430c7df8d5ba33c783ba44177ec0b40d OP_EQUAL
address
MFGsz7g7xjSLWh5LNmmCu99xoHGKHdweKG
transaction
91abb60091ef647466dcbc0920be9e87aa5f57186972efae70633921e3d9d626
spent
true